The Benefits and Risks of Turning Apache Server Signature Off
The Importance of Server Signature
If you own a website, you know how important it is to keep it safe and secure. There are various measures you can implement to ensure a high level of security, such as using a firewall, installing antivirus software, and using SSL certificates. One of these measures is to turn off the server signature.
The server signature is an HTTP header that displays information about the web server being used. It shows important details such as the software version and the operating system. While this information is useful for developers and system administrators, it can also be used by hackers to launch attacks on your website.
The Benefits of Turning Off the Server Signature
Turning off the server signature can provide a number of benefits for website owners, including:
Improved Security
By turning off the server signature, you remove valuable information that hackers can use to exploit vulnerabilities in your website. This means that turning off the server signature can help prevent attacks such as cross-site scripting (XSS), SQL injection, and other vulnerabilities.
Increased Privacy
The server signature also reveals information about the software and version of your web server, which can be used by hackers to target specific vulnerabilities. By turning off the server signature, you protect your website from these attacks and also improve your privacy.
Reduced Bandwidth Usage
The server signature can also add unnecessary data to your website’s HTTP response headers, which can increase the size of the response and lead to slower page loading times. Turning off the server signature can reduce the amount of data sent between the web server and the client, resulting in faster page load speeds.
Better SEO
Search engines such as Google consider page speed as a ranking factor. By turning off the server signature, you can improve page load times and potentially improve your search engine rankings.
The Risks of Turning off the Server Signature
While turning off the server signature can bring several benefits, there are also a few risks that need to be considered:
Difficulty in Debugging
The server signature provides valuable information to developers and system administrators, which can help them troubleshoot issues with the website. By turning off the server signature, this information is not available, making it harder to debug any issues that may arise.
Limited Compatibility
Some web applications and services rely on the server signature to function properly. Turning off the server signature can cause compatibility issues with certain applications, which can impact the functionality of your website.
Non-Standard Configuration
Turning off the server signature is not a standard configuration. This means that it can cause confusion and may even lead to other security issues if not properly implemented.
How to Turn off the Server Signature in Apache
If you decide to turn off the server signature in Apache, here’s how to do it:
Step
Action
1
Open your Apache configuration file (httpd.conf) in a text editor.
2
Locate the line that contains “ServerSignature On”.
3
Change “ServerSignature On” to “ServerSignature Off”.
4
Save the file and restart the Apache web server.
FAQs
1. What is a server signature?
A server signature is an HTTP header that displays information about the web server being used, including the software version and operating system.
2. Why turn off the server signature in Apache?
Turning off the server signature can improve security, privacy, and page load times, potentially improving your search engine rankings.
3. What are the risks of turning off the server signature?
The risks of turning off the server signature include difficulty in debugging, compatibility issues, and non-standard configuration.
4. How do I turn off the server signature in Apache?
To turn off the server signature in Apache, open the configuration file (httpd.conf), locate the line containing “ServerSignature On,” change it to “ServerSignature Off,” save the file, and restart the Apache web server.
5. Will turning off the server signature make my website completely secure?
No, turning off the server signature is just one measure you can implement to improve website security.
6. Will turning off the server signature impact website functionality?
Turning off the server signature can cause compatibility issues with certain web applications and services.
7. Is turning off the server signature a standard configuration?
No, turning off the server signature is not a standard configuration, which can lead to confusion and other security issues if not properly implemented.
8. Can I turn off the server signature on other web servers?
Yes, most web servers allow you to turn off the server signature in the configuration file.
9. What other measures can I take to improve website security?
You can implement measures such as using a firewall, installing antivirus software, using SSL certificates, and keeping your software up to date.
10. What is cross-site scripting (XSS)?
Cross-site scripting (XSS) is a type of security vulnerability where an attacker injects malicious code into a website to steal information from users.
11. What is SQL injection?
SQL injection is a type of security vulnerability where an attacker uses SQL commands to gain unauthorized access to a website’s database.
12. Why is page load speed important?
Page load speed is important because it impacts user experience and search engine rankings.
13. How can I improve page load speeds?
You can improve page load speeds by optimizing images, minifying CSS and JavaScript files, using a content delivery network (CDN), and turning off the server signature.
Conclusion
In conclusion, turning off the server signature in Apache can provide several benefits for website owners, including improved security, privacy, and page load times. However, it’s important to be aware of the risks and potential compatibility issues that come with turning off the server signature. Website owners should weigh the pros and cons before implementing this measure, and ensure that it’s done correctly to avoid any security issues.
If you decide to turn off the server signature, follow the steps above to do it correctly. And remember, turning off the server signature is just one measure you can take to improve website security. It’s important to implement other measures such as using a firewall, installing antivirus software, and keeping your software up to date to ensure a high level of security for your website.
Closing Disclaimer
The information provided in this article is for educational purposes only and does not constitute professional advice. Website owners should consult with a qualified professional to determine the best measures to improve website security.
Video:The Benefits and Risks of Turning Apache Server Signature Off
Related Posts:
Turn Off Apache Server Signature Say Goodbye to Apache Server Signature and Secure Your Website Welcome to our comprehensive guide on how to turn off Apache server signature. If you own a website or blog,…
Apache Server Header Codes: Everything You Need to Know IntroductionHello there! If you're reading this article, chances are you're interested in learning more about Apache server header codes. In today's digital age, having an understanding of these codes is…
what is apache server signature Title: Exploring Apache Server Signature: The Advantages and Disadvantages🚩 IntroductionWelcome to the informative world of Apache Server Signature! This article is designed to educate you on the ins and outs…
What You Need to Know About Apache Server Signature The Importance of Understanding Apache Server Signature for Your WebsiteAs a website owner, it is essential to have an understanding of the security and privacy aspects of your website. This…
Ubuntu Apache Server Signature Off: The Ultimate Guide IntroductionGreetings, dear readers! Welcome to our comprehensive guide on Ubuntu Apache Server Signature Off. If you're a beginner or a seasoned developer, this guide will help you understand what it…
Apache Fake Server Signature: Everything You Need to Know Introduction Welcome, dear readers, to this informative article about Apache fake server signature. In this article, we will discuss the concept of an Apache server signature, its importance, and the…
Apache Disable Server Signature: What You Need to Know 🔒 Keep Your Server Secure with Apache Disable Server Signature 🔒When it comes to server security, there are many measures that you can take to keep your website safe from…
Apache Ignoring Server Signature Off: An In-Depth Guide Introduction Greetings, readers! In this digital era, having a secure and well-protected website is a top priority for every online business. With multiple vulnerabilities emerging every day, website administrators must…
Protecting Your Website from Malicious Actors: Understanding… IntroductionGreetings to our dear readers who are concerned about their website's security! We understand that keeping your online presence safe and secured is a top priority. In the digital age,…
Ubuntu Apache Server Signature Off: The Pros and Cons The Importance of Server SecurityIn today's digital age, server security has become a critical concern for individuals and organizations alike. Cyber attacks are constantly evolving, and hackers are always looking…
Nginx Change HTTP Server Signature: A Comprehensive Guide IntroductionGreetings to all our readers who are interested in webserver security. At some point, most website owners are concerned about their server security and privacy. We at [company name] understand…
Apache Remove Server Signature: Everything You Need to Know Introduction:Greetings to all the web developers and website owners out there! If you are reading this, then you probably want to learn more about Apache Remove Server Signature. Have you…
Apache Server Signature Off: Understanding It’s Advantages… 👀 Introduction: Know What Apache Server Signature Off is All AboutWelcome to this comprehensive journal article about Apache Server Signature Off. You might ask, “What is this all about?” Well,…
Hide Server Signature Nginx: A Comprehensive Guide IntroductionWelcome to our guide on how to hide server signature nginx! In today's digital world, website security is of utmost importance. However, most servers reveal critical server information, such as…
Apache Completely Disable Server Signature: The Ultimate… IntroductionGreetings, fellow website owners and developers! In the world of online security, one of the most crucial elements is the server signature. It is a useful piece of information since…
Unlocking the Benefits of Apache Add Server Header Introduction: Setting the Stage for Apache Add Server HeaderGreetings, esteemed readers! As you join us today, we are excited to explore the world of Apache Add Server Header – a…
Nginx Remove Server Signature: The Ultimate Guide IntroductionGreetings audience! In today's digital age, web security has become an essential aspect of the online world. Nginx, a popular web server, provides excellent security features, including the option to…
How to Fix the "Server's Host Key Did Not Match the… Welcome to this journal article, Dev. In this article, we will discuss the common error message "Server's Host Key Did Not Match the Signature Supplied" that you might encounter while…
Apache Server Hide - Secure Your Website and Data IntroductionWelcome to our journal article about Apache server hide! In this article, we will be discussing the importance of hiding your Apache server and the advantages and disadvantages of doing…
How to Fix "Signature from Server's Host Key is Invalid" Greetings, Dev! Are you experiencing issues with your SSH connection? Are you seeing the error message "signature from server's host key is invalid"? Well, fear not, as we have gathered…
Apache Error Remove Server Version: What You Need to Know IntroductionGreetings, fellow web developers and server administrators! Today, we will be discussing Apache Error Remove Server Version and its impact on website security and search engine optimization. As you may…
Server Host Key Did Not Match the Signature Supplied: A… Greetings, Devs! In this article, we will tackle the common issue of "server host key did not match the signature supplied" and provide you a comprehensive guide to resolving it.…
Debian Change Server HTTP Header: Everything You Need to… IntroductionHello, dear readers. Are you curious about how to change the server HTTP header on your Debian system? Look no further! In this article, we will guide you through everything…
Obscure Server Identity Apache: A Comprehensive Guide Introduction: Understanding Obscure Server Identity Apache Welcome to our detailed guide on Obscure Server Identity Apache! This article is designed to provide a comprehensive overview of this technology and its…
CentOS Apache Server Signature Token A Comprehensive Guide to Understanding How to Improve Your Website's SecurityGreetings, fellow tech enthusiasts! With the rise of e-commerce, online businesses need to prioritize the security of their websites to…
Editing Apache Server Header: An In-Depth Guide The Importance of Editing Apache Server HeaderApache is one of the most commonly used web servers on the internet. It is open-source and has a large community of contributors who…
Nginx Hide Server: Why It's a Must for Your Website Introduction: Greetings to Our AudienceHello and welcome to our latest article on web development! Today, we will be discussing a crucial aspect of server security - Nginx Hide Server. As…
Nginx Server Token Off: Everything You Need to Know Introduction: Welcoming the AudienceWelcome to our comprehensive guide on Nginx Server Token Off. In this article, we will enlighten you about the importance of Nginx Server Token Off, its advantages…